Cessna 172K N84385

9 September 1999 · Pickrell, Nebraska, United States · No injuries

Summary

On 9 September 1999 at about 02:40 local time, a Cessna 172K registered N84385, operated by Mark Chase, was involved in an accident near Pickrell, Nebraska, United States. 2 people were on board and nobody was injured. The aircraft was substantially damaged. The NTSB has published a probable cause for this accident; it is quoted in full below.

Probable cause

the loose oil dipstick guide tube resulting in loss of oil and the engine failure. The night condition was a contributing factor.

Quoted verbatim from the NTSB record. This site does not paraphrase or interpret it.

Read the full NTSB narrative

The airplane impacted terrain during a night forced landing after experiencing a loss of engine power. The pilot also stated that the engine was running so rough that it felt as if it had half a propeller and that he could not read the airspeed indicator or altimeter. He circled twice over an unlit gravel road and then touched down twice on the road before impacting a sign. The pilot stated that he made the landing with 15 degrees of flaps and not full flaps since it took two hands to fly the aircraft because of the vibration. Examination of the engine revealed that the engine oil dipstick guide tube was loose which resulted in a loss of engine oil.
